Message ID | 20210525174242.27509-3-marek.behun@nic.cz |
---|---|
State | Accepted |
Commit | 3d9c1d5ddac8f040730c228086a083214e992419 |
Delegated to: | Stefan Roese |
Headers | show |
Series | Support higher baudrates on Armada 3720 UART | expand |
On 25.05.21 19:42, Marek Behún wrote: > Setting DM_FLAG_PRE_RELOC for Armada 3720 clock drivers (TBG and > peripheral clocks) makes it possible for serial driver to retrieve clock > rates via clk API. > > Signed-off-by: Marek Behún <marek.behun@nic.cz> Reviewed-by: Stefan Roese <sr@denx.de> Thanks, Stefan > --- > drivers/clk/mvebu/armada-37xx-periph.c | 1 + > drivers/clk/mvebu/armada-37xx-tbg.c | 1 + > 2 files changed, 2 insertions(+) > > diff --git a/drivers/clk/mvebu/armada-37xx-periph.c b/drivers/clk/mvebu/armada-37xx-periph.c > index b0f47c33b3..3b767d7060 100644 > --- a/drivers/clk/mvebu/armada-37xx-periph.c > +++ b/drivers/clk/mvebu/armada-37xx-periph.c > @@ -626,4 +626,5 @@ U_BOOT_DRIVER(armada_37xx_periph_clk) = { > .ops = &armada_37xx_periph_clk_ops, > .priv_auto = sizeof(struct a37xx_periphclk), > .probe = armada_37xx_periph_clk_probe, > + .flags = DM_FLAG_PRE_RELOC, > }; > diff --git a/drivers/clk/mvebu/armada-37xx-tbg.c b/drivers/clk/mvebu/armada-37xx-tbg.c > index b1c0852e89..054aff5e6a 100644 > --- a/drivers/clk/mvebu/armada-37xx-tbg.c > +++ b/drivers/clk/mvebu/armada-37xx-tbg.c > @@ -152,4 +152,5 @@ U_BOOT_DRIVER(armada_37xx_tbg_clk) = { > .ops = &armada_37xx_tbg_clk_ops, > .priv_auto = sizeof(struct a37xx_tbgclk), > .probe = armada_37xx_tbg_clk_probe, > + .flags = DM_FLAG_PRE_RELOC, > }; > Viele Grüße, Stefan
diff --git a/drivers/clk/mvebu/armada-37xx-periph.c b/drivers/clk/mvebu/armada-37xx-periph.c index b0f47c33b3..3b767d7060 100644 --- a/drivers/clk/mvebu/armada-37xx-periph.c +++ b/drivers/clk/mvebu/armada-37xx-periph.c @@ -626,4 +626,5 @@ U_BOOT_DRIVER(armada_37xx_periph_clk) = { .ops = &armada_37xx_periph_clk_ops, .priv_auto = sizeof(struct a37xx_periphclk), .probe = armada_37xx_periph_clk_probe, + .flags = DM_FLAG_PRE_RELOC, }; diff --git a/drivers/clk/mvebu/armada-37xx-tbg.c b/drivers/clk/mvebu/armada-37xx-tbg.c index b1c0852e89..054aff5e6a 100644 --- a/drivers/clk/mvebu/armada-37xx-tbg.c +++ b/drivers/clk/mvebu/armada-37xx-tbg.c @@ -152,4 +152,5 @@ U_BOOT_DRIVER(armada_37xx_tbg_clk) = { .ops = &armada_37xx_tbg_clk_ops, .priv_auto = sizeof(struct a37xx_tbgclk), .probe = armada_37xx_tbg_clk_probe, + .flags = DM_FLAG_PRE_RELOC, };
Setting DM_FLAG_PRE_RELOC for Armada 3720 clock drivers (TBG and peripheral clocks) makes it possible for serial driver to retrieve clock rates via clk API. Signed-off-by: Marek Behún <marek.behun@nic.cz> --- drivers/clk/mvebu/armada-37xx-periph.c | 1 + drivers/clk/mvebu/armada-37xx-tbg.c | 1 + 2 files changed, 2 insertions(+)